Cornwall — Snakes are cool animals, helpful to the environment but very misunderstood. On Saturday, Jan. 12, the Hudson Highlands Nature Museum presents “Snakes Alive!,” a program that will introduce children to some of the snakes who live at the museum’s Wildlife Education Center, 25 Boulevard, Cornwall-on-Hudson. Two presentations of the program will be offered, one at 10 a.m. and another at 11:30 a.m. Interpreters will show some of the snakes’ amazing adaptations. Kids will create their own snake craft to take home. The program is recommended for ages 5 and up. The cost is $5, or $3 for members.
